Frequently asked questions
The depreciation rate can be influenced by factors such as the vehicle's condition, mileage, market demand, and the pace of technological advancements in newer models.
While not necessary, decoding a VIN for a routine service appointment can provide the mechanic with precise model information, facilitating accurate service and parts replacement.
Test vehicle status, if reported, reveals use in trials or development, which may involve experimental features and adjustments in the 2017 GMC YUKON.
Some models may depreciate faster due to factors like lower demand, higher maintenance costs, or outdated technology compared to newer versions.
These records, if available, detail instances of major damage and subsequent dispositions, essential for evaluating the past treatment and current state of the 2017 GMC YUKON.
Factors to consider when estimating the future resale value include the car's historical depreciation rate, current market trends, overall vehicle condition, and mileage.
While a VIN decoder can provide the model year that can suggest warranty status, verifying the actual warranty status usually requires direct contact with the manufacturer or dealer.
Proper maintenance and good condition can slow the depreciation of a 2017 GMC YUKON by making it more attractive to potential buyers, thereby preserving more of its value.
Federal highway inspection data for 2017 GMC vehicles may include inspection dates and details on safety, driver, and hazardous materials violations, if such inspections have been documented.
On average, a new car can depreciate by approximately 23% after the first year, reflecting the premium paid for new technology and immediate depreciation once it's considered used.
